How To Clean An Iron Plate When Burnt - The QUICK, CHEAP and EASY METHOD
This video is a simple, but effective one.
It shows you how to clean a burnt iron the cheapest and quickest way.
It happens to everyone. Your iron is set too high and you run it over a piece of clothing that burns easily and now you have burn marks on your iron.
Like me, most people would try to scrap it off on the edge of the ironing board, or scrub it off with something abrasive, but that will only damage the ceramic coating - if your iron has one - on the sole plate so you should avoid doing.
It’s safer on you iron plate to use the method in this video than any abrasive method, and it will clean your iron bottom and make it look new again.

    When I was a projectionist using carbon arc rods for the light source, we used Bon Ami to remove the debris from the mirrors. Dry first, then mixed with a little water to make a paste. Bon Ami will not scratch glass and will remove anything from the glass with enough rubbing. Even burned on sugar can be removed this way.

    Still limescale on the element, which should be a shiny silver as new, as for the floor of the kettle. Now... In an empty kettle flood the element and kettle floor with only white/clear vinegar. Let it work for about three minutes then SCRUB gently with a washing up brush, steel scourer, until the calcium is gone. IF your calcium is still on after that, you have more aggressive calcium/or just more, in your water So. Boil 1 cup of water with half cup of same vinegar which makes calcium come off more. 2-3 times should have it like new if you scrub as before AFTER the boil (careful to let it cool for a minute or two after boiling. Waters vary, your water has more or less calcium than other locations. More = more build up in your boiler and kettle (if the municipal water goes in there). Aluminium/Titanium/steel rods (anode) rods are used in boilers these days to prolong the life of your water boilers. A couple of decades ago, people started using those metal scourers (like the current vileda's 'Glitzi' scouring balls), but they were tiny back then, purely for the kettle, doing the same job as a boiler anode rod, which is to absorb the heavy calcium deposits and keep your kettle looking new. So - it's in the water - if you keep putting 'hard' water in your kettle, your going to have to keep the kettle scourer IN, or clean your kettle every evening/week, according to your build up.
